Reviewers mostly see bolt.new as a fast, low-friction way to turn prompts into working web apps, mockups, landing pages, and MVPs directly in the browser, with no local setup. Users praise how quickly it scaffolds full-stack projects and produces editable code, while makers of Composio, Magic Hour, and Rankfender echo its value for rapid prototyping. The main complaints are opaque and heavy token use, buggy error-fixing loops or over-rewrites on larger projects, weak collaboration limits, and slow or unresponsive support.
